Amnesia Gold: Pure Sativa Excellence from Pyramid Seeds
Amnesia Gold represents Pyramid Seeds' pursuit of a lean, high-octane sativa that combines speed with serious resin production. Born from Lennon and Amnesia Haze parentage, this 75% sativa cultivar brings together zippy growth characteristics and potent cannabinoid profiles that appeal to growers seeking an energetic, uplifting finish. At 26% THC, Amnesia Gold is uncompromising in its strength. Indoor cultivators across Canada—from coastal BC grow rooms to Prairie basements—have embraced this strain for its predictable 10–11 week run and responsive yields when light intensity and nutrient schedules are optimised.
Growing Amnesia Gold Indoors and Outdoors
Amnesia Gold thrives under controlled indoor conditions where photoperiod management locks in its rapid progression. Space plants 50–60 cm apart to accommodate moderate lateral stretch; expect vigorous vegetative branching typical of sativa-leaning genetics. Maintain daytime temperatures between 22–26°C and humidity below 50% post-flowering to minimise moisture-related stress. Outdoors in temperate Canadian zones (coastal British Columbia, parts of Ontario), Amnesia Gold finishes before first frost, making it viable for growers with shorter growing seasons. Feed with sativa-focused nutrient ratios—higher nitrogen early, phosphorus-rich bloom phase. Indoor yields reward precision: dial in 18+ hours of 600–1000 µmol/m² light intensity for substantial dry returns within the 10–11 week flowering window.
Uplifting Effects and Complex Flavour Profile
Amnesia Gold's sativa dominance shines in its mental clarity and sustained euphoria, making it favoured for daytime or social use. Users report sharp focus, creative stimulation, and energetic motivation rather than sedation. Flavour develops as citrus, pine, and subtle herbal undertones with a clean, resinous finish on exhale. The aroma during late flowering carries peppery, lemony notes that intensify in the final weeks. Best enjoyed in morning or midday contexts when you need motivation and mental engagement without the heaviness of indica-leaning strains.
